Output 3c7723600bcf2035a31b84e79dc4cddeee8764dba45afb65e3de065408af4e2a:0

value
3607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b81b216596789d2d6659215fdd201c30b92f624 OP_EQUAL
address
3Cx4QYuRWHdkxwaTq6J6j8gpEyV5W2iYMd
transaction
3c7723600bcf2035a31b84e79dc4cddeee8764dba45afb65e3de065408af4e2a
confirmations
139050
spent
true